Immersive Integration & Real-Time Feedback
Wearables showcased at global sports shows are evolving from simple trackers into intelligent training companions. They now seamlessly integrate with smart gym equipment, virtual reality (VR) and augmented reality (AR) platforms, and performance-focused mobile apps. Real-time voice and motion guidance, posture correction through haptic signals, and interactive coaching environments help athletes improve technique and prevent injuries with immediate personalized feedback. This immersive experience turns training into a fully responsive, data-driven journey.
Material Innovation & Ultra-Comfortable Design
Comfort and durability have become key priorities in wearable innovation. Exhibitions are highlighting devices built with stretchable circuits, breathable smart fabrics, and seamless sensor integration, allowing athletes to train freely without discomfort or distraction. Smart compression shirts, embedded-sensor leggings, and performance footwear designed with lightweight flexible materials are gaining popularity. Sustainability is also becoming central, with brands developing eco-friendly wearable products made from recycled fibers and plant-based materials, ensuring technology and environmental responsibility go hand in hand.
Performance Recovery & Injury-Prevention Technology
Modern wearables are shifting beyond performance tracking to focus on proactive recovery and injury prevention. Advanced compression gear, hydration-monitoring bands, AI-based rehabilitation tools, and muscle-monitoring sensors help athletes manage fatigue and avoid strain. Many innovations showcased at international events also support post-training recovery through vibration therapy, micro-stimulation, and guided stretching features. These technologies make it easier for athletes to recover efficiently, maintain peak form, and extend their performance longevity.
